1. Why Am I Not Receiving Calls from Unknown Numbers?

You might not be receiving calls from unknown numbers because of features like “Silence Unknown Callers” or blocked contact lists, designed to filter out spam but potentially blocking important business opportunities. It’s essential to adjust these settings to ensure you don’t miss valuable calls.

Many iPhone users find themselves in situations where they unintentionally block calls from unknown numbers. Several features and settings can cause this, leading to missed opportunities and potential frustration. Understanding these reasons is the first step to resolving the issue and ensuring you receive all important calls.

  • Silence Unknown Callers: This feature, introduced in iOS 13, sends calls from numbers not in your contacts directly to voicemail. While effective at reducing spam, it can also block legitimate calls from potential business partners. To check if this feature is enabled, go to Settings > Phone > Silence Unknown Callers. If it’s toggled on, switch it off to allow calls from unknown numbers to ring through.

  • Blocked Contact List: You might have accidentally blocked a number. To check your blocked list, go to Settings > Phone > Blocked Contacts. Review the list and unblock any numbers you want to receive calls from. This is a common cause, especially if you’ve been actively blocking spam numbers.

  • Focus Mode: Focus modes like “Do Not Disturb” can silence incoming calls, including those from unknown numbers. Check your Control Center or go to Settings > Focus to ensure no focus mode is active that might be filtering your calls.

  • Call Filtering Apps: Third-party apps designed to block spam calls can sometimes be overzealous and block legitimate unknown numbers. Review the settings of any call filtering apps you have installed to ensure they are not blocking important calls. Consider temporarily disabling these apps to see if it resolves the issue.

  • Carrier Settings: In some cases, your mobile carrier might offer call blocking or filtering services that could be affecting your ability to receive calls from unknown numbers. Contact your carrier’s customer support to inquire about any such services and how to disable them if necessary.

  • iOS Updates: Occasionally, software updates can change settings or introduce new features that affect call handling. After an iOS update, double-check your phone settings to ensure that call filtering features are configured to your preferences.

2. How Do I Turn Off Silence Unknown Callers on My iPhone?

Turning off “Silence Unknown Callers” is straightforward: go to Settings > Phone > Silence Unknown Callers and toggle the switch to the OFF position, allowing all calls to come through. This ensures you don’t miss potential business opportunities.

The “Silence Unknown Callers” feature on iPhones is designed to help users avoid unwanted spam and robocalls. When enabled, this feature automatically sends calls from numbers not in your contacts list to voicemail, preventing your phone from ringing. However, this can also lead to missing important calls from new contacts, potential clients, or crucial business partners. Turning off this feature is a simple process that can ensure you receive all incoming calls.

  1. Open the Settings App: Locate the Settings app on your iPhone’s home screen. It is usually represented by a gray gear icon. Tap the icon to open the app.
  2. Scroll Down and Tap “Phone”: In the Settings menu, scroll down until you find the option labeled Phone. Tap on Phone to access the phone settings.
  3. Find “Silence Unknown Callers”: In the Phone settings, scroll down until you see Silence Unknown Callers. This option is typically located under the “CALLS” section.
  4. Toggle the Switch to “Off”: Tap on Silence Unknown Callers. You will see a switch next to the feature’s name. If the switch is green, it means the feature is currently enabled. Tap the switch to toggle it to the Off position. The switch will turn gray when the feature is disabled.

Once you have turned off the “Silence Unknown Callers” feature, your iPhone will now ring when you receive calls from numbers that are not saved in your contacts list. This ensures that you won’t miss important calls from potential business partners, new clients, or other important contacts.

3. How Do I Unblock a Number on My iPhone?

To unblock a number, navigate to Settings > Phone > Blocked Contacts. Find the number you want to unblock and tap “Edit” in the top right corner, then tap the red minus sign next to the number and “Unblock”. This ensures you can receive calls from previously blocked business contacts.

Sometimes, you might accidentally block a contact or need to unblock a number that you previously blocked. Unblocking a number on your iPhone is a straightforward process that ensures you can receive calls and messages from that contact again. Here’s how to do it:

  1. Open the Settings App: Start by opening the Settings app on your iPhone. This is the app with the gray gear icon, usually found on your home screen.
  2. Go to the “Phone” Section: Scroll down in the Settings menu until you find the Phone option. Tap on Phone to open the phone settings.
  3. Access “Blocked Contacts”: In the Phone settings, scroll down until you see the Blocked Contacts option. Tap on Blocked Contacts to view the list of numbers you have blocked.
  4. Edit the Blocked List: At the top right corner of the Blocked Contacts screen, you will see an Edit button. Tap on Edit to enter edit mode.
  5. Unblock the Number: In edit mode, you will see a red circle with a white minus sign next to each blocked number. Tap the red circle next to the number you wish to unblock. A red Unblock button will appear to the right of the number. Tap the Unblock button to remove the number from your blocked list.
  6. Confirm Unblocking: Once you tap Unblock, the number will be removed from the list of blocked contacts.
  7. Finish Editing: After unblocking all the numbers you want to unblock, tap the Done button at the top right corner of the screen to exit edit mode.

4. What If I Still Can’t Receive Calls from Unknown Numbers?

If you’ve turned off “Silence Unknown Callers” and unblocked necessary numbers but still face issues, check your Focus modes, call forwarding settings, and any third-party call-blocking apps. Ensure none of these are interfering with incoming calls.

Even after turning off “Silence Unknown Callers” and unblocking numbers, you might still experience issues receiving calls from unknown numbers. Several other factors could be at play, and systematically addressing them will help you identify and resolve the problem.

  1. Check Focus Modes:
    • What to Do: Focus Modes, like “Do Not Disturb,” can prevent calls from ringing through. To check, swipe down from the top-right corner of your screen to open the Control Center. If any Focus mode is active (highlighted), tap it to turn it off.
    • Why: Focus modes can be set to silence calls and notifications, which might unintentionally block calls from unknown numbers.
  2. Review Call Forwarding Settings:
    • What to Do: Go to Settings > Phone > Call Forwarding. Ensure that Call Forwarding is turned off.
    • Why: If Call Forwarding is enabled, incoming calls might be redirected to another number, preventing them from reaching your phone.
  3. Examine Third-Party Call-Blocking Apps:
    • What to Do: If you use apps like Nomorobo or Truecaller, review their settings. These apps might be blocking calls even if “Silence Unknown Callers” is off. Try temporarily disabling these apps to see if the issue resolves.
    • Why: These apps filter calls based on their own criteria, which might be more aggressive than your iPhone’s built-in settings.
  4. Verify Carrier Settings:
    • What to Do: Contact your mobile carrier to ensure there are no network-level call-blocking services active on your account.
    • Why: Some carriers offer services that block spam calls at the network level, which could interfere with your ability to receive calls from unknown numbers.
  5. Reset Network Settings:
    • What to Do: Go to Settings > General > Transfer or Reset iPhone > Reset > Reset Network Settings. Note that this will reset your Wi-Fi passwords, so make sure you have them handy.
    • Why: Resetting network settings can resolve issues caused by incorrect or corrupted network configurations.
  6. Update iOS:
    • What to Do: Go to Settings > General > Software Update to ensure your iPhone is running the latest version of iOS.
    • Why: Software updates often include bug fixes that can resolve issues with call handling.
  7. Check Blocked Contacts Again:
    • What to Do: Go to Settings > Phone > Blocked Contacts and double-check that no important numbers are accidentally blocked.
    • Why: It’s always good to ensure no important contacts are mistakenly on the blocked list.
  8. Test with Another Phone:
    • What to Do: Ask a friend to call you from a number not in your contacts to see if the call goes through.
    • Why: This helps determine if the issue is with your phone or with the caller’s number or network.

6. Can Call Blocking Apps Interfere with Receiving Calls?

Yes, call-blocking apps can interfere with receiving calls by aggressively filtering numbers, sometimes blocking legitimate calls. Review these apps’ settings to ensure they’re not over-blocking and adjust them to allow calls from potential business contacts.

Call-blocking apps are designed to help users manage unwanted calls, such as spam, robocalls, and telemarketing calls. While these apps can be very effective at reducing unwanted interruptions, they can also interfere with your ability to receive legitimate calls if not properly configured. Understanding how these apps work and how to manage their settings is crucial to ensure you don’t miss important communications.

  1. How Call-Blocking Apps Work:

    • Database of Spam Numbers: Most call-blocking apps maintain a database of known spam numbers. When an incoming call matches a number in this database, the app automatically blocks the call or sends it to voicemail.
    • Heuristic Analysis: Some apps use heuristic analysis to identify potential spam calls. This involves analyzing call patterns and other data to determine the likelihood that a call is unwanted.
    • User-Reported Numbers: Many apps allow users to report spam numbers, which are then added to the app’s database and shared with other users.
  2. Potential Interference:

    • Overly Aggressive Blocking: Call-blocking apps can sometimes be overly aggressive in their filtering, blocking legitimate calls from numbers that are not in your contacts list.
    • Misidentification of Numbers: Legitimate numbers can sometimes be misidentified as spam, especially if they are new or not widely recognized.
    • Conflicting Settings: Conflicts can arise between the settings of different call-blocking apps or between the app settings and your iPhone’s built-in features like “Silence Unknown Callers.”
  3. Managing Call-Blocking Apps:

    • Review App Settings: Regularly review the settings of your call-blocking apps to ensure they are configured to your preferences. Pay attention to options such as the level of blocking aggressiveness and the criteria used to identify spam calls.
    • Check Blocked Lists: Most call-blocking apps maintain a list of blocked numbers. Review this list periodically to ensure that no legitimate numbers have been accidentally blocked.
    • Whitelist Important Numbers: Many apps allow you to create a whitelist of numbers that should never be blocked. Add important contacts, potential business partners, and other numbers you want to ensure always ring through.
    • Adjust Blocking Sensitivity: Some apps allow you to adjust the sensitivity of their blocking algorithms. If you find that the app is blocking too many legitimate calls, try reducing the sensitivity.
    • Update App Regularly: Ensure that your call-blocking apps are regularly updated to take advantage of the latest spam identification techniques and bug fixes.
    • Monitor Call Activity: Keep an eye on your call history and voicemail messages to identify any missed calls from unknown numbers that might have been blocked by the app.
    • Test App Performance: Periodically test the performance of your call-blocking apps by having a friend call you from a number that is not in your contacts list. This will help you ensure that the app is working as expected and not blocking legitimate calls.
  4. Alternatives to Call-Blocking Apps:

    • Carrier Services: Consider using call-blocking services provided by your mobile carrier. These services are often integrated into the network infrastructure and can be more reliable than third-party apps.
    • iPhone’s Built-In Features: Utilize your iPhone’s built-in features such as “Silence Unknown Callers” and the ability to block individual numbers. These features can provide a basic level of call management without the need for additional apps.

7. How Do I Report Spam Calls to Prevent Future Issues?

Reporting spam calls helps improve call filtering services for you and others. On your iPhone, after receiving a spam call, you can block the number and then report it to your carrier or through third-party apps designed for this purpose.

Reporting spam calls is a proactive step that helps improve call filtering services and reduces the likelihood of receiving similar unwanted calls in the future. By reporting these calls, you contribute to a collective effort to combat spam and robocalls. Here’s how you can report spam calls effectively:

  1. Identify the Spam Call:

    • Recognize Spam Indicators: Be aware of common indicators of spam calls, such as unknown numbers, repeated calls from the same number, calls received at odd hours, and prerecorded messages.
    • Use Caller ID Apps: Caller ID apps like Truecaller or Nomorobo can help identify potential spam calls as they come in, making it easier to decide whether to answer or report the call.
  2. Block the Number:

    • Block on Your iPhone: After receiving a spam call, block the number directly on your iPhone. Go to the Phone app, tap the Recents tab, find the number, tap the (i) icon next to the number, scroll down, and tap Block this Caller.
    • Why Block: Blocking the number prevents the spammer from calling you again from that specific number.
  3. Report to Your Mobile Carrier:

    • Contact Your Carrier: Many mobile carriers have specific procedures for reporting spam calls. Contact your carrier’s customer support or visit their website to find out the recommended method.
    • Use Short Codes: Some carriers provide short codes that you can text with the spam number. For example, you can forward the spam text message to 7726 (SPAM) if you receive a spam text.
    • Carrier Apps: Some carriers have mobile apps that allow you to report spam calls directly through the app.
    • Why Report to Carrier: Reporting to your carrier helps them identify and block spam numbers at the network level, protecting more users.
  4. Report to Government Agencies:

    • Federal Trade Commission (FTC): In the United States, you can report spam calls to the FTC. Visit the FTC’s website at ReportFraud.ftc.gov and provide details about the call, such as the date, time, and number.
    • Federal Communications Commission (FCC): You can also report spam calls to the FCC. Visit the FCC’s website and file a complaint with their Consumer Complaint Center.
    • Why Report to Government: These agencies use the data to track down and prosecute spammers and robocallers.
  5. Use Third-Party Apps:

    • Spam Reporting Apps: Several third-party apps specialize in identifying and reporting spam calls. These apps often have features that allow you to report spam calls directly from the app.
    • Examples: Popular apps include Truecaller, Nomorobo, and Hiya. These apps often have built-in mechanisms for reporting spam calls to their databases.
    • How to Use: Download and install a spam reporting app. Follow the app’s instructions to report the spam call. This typically involves providing details about the call, such as the number, date, and time.
    • Why Use Apps: These apps help to aggregate spam reports and share the information with other users, improving the accuracy of spam identification.
  6. Keep Your Contact Information Private:

    • Avoid Sharing Publicly: Be cautious about sharing your phone number and other contact information on public websites or online forms.
    • Review Privacy Settings: Review the privacy settings on social media and other online accounts to limit who can see your contact information.
    • Why Keep Private: Limiting the exposure of your contact information reduces the chances of it falling into the hands of spammers.

10. What Are Some Common Scams Related to Unknown Callers?

Be aware of common scams such as IRS impersonation, tech support fraud, and lottery scams. Never provide personal or financial information to unknown callers. If something sounds too good to be true, it probably is.

Unknown callers can sometimes be scammers attempting to deceive you for financial gain or to steal your personal information. Awareness of common scam tactics is crucial for protecting yourself. Here are some of the most prevalent scams associated with unknown callers:

  1. IRS Impersonation Scams:
    • How it Works: Scammers pose as IRS agents and claim you owe back taxes. They often use aggressive and threatening language to pressure you into making immediate payments.
    • Red Flags:
      • Threats of arrest or legal action.
      • Demands for immediate payment via wire transfer, prepaid debit card, or gift cards.
      • Refusal to provide official documentation.
    • Protect Yourself:
      • The IRS always sends official notices by mail before calling.
      • Never provide financial information over the phone.
      • Verify any claims by contacting the IRS directly at their official number.
  2. Tech Support Scams:
    • How it Works: Scammers claim to be tech support representatives from well-known companies like Microsoft or Apple. They tell you that your computer has been infected with a virus and offer to fix it for a fee.
    • Red Flags:
      • Unsolicited calls claiming your computer has a virus.
      • Requests for remote access to your computer.
      • Demands for payment to fix a nonexistent problem.
    • Protect Yourself:
      • Never give remote access to your computer to unsolicited callers.
      • Hang up and contact your tech support provider directly using their official contact information.
      • Be wary of pop-up ads claiming your computer is infected with a virus.
  3. Lottery and Sweepstakes Scams:
    • How it Works: Scammers inform you that you have won a lottery or sweepstakes but need to pay fees or taxes to claim your prize.
    • Red Flags:
      • Requests for upfront payments to claim a prize.
      • Claims of winning a lottery or sweepstakes you never entered.
      • Pressure to act quickly to claim your prize.
    • Protect Yourself:
      • Never pay any fees or taxes to claim a prize.
      • Be skeptical of unsolicited notifications of winning a lottery or sweepstakes.
      • Remember, if it sounds too good to be true, it probably is.
  4. Grandparent Scams:
    • How it Works: Scammers pose as a grandchild in distress and call grandparents asking for money to help with an emergency, such as a car accident, medical bill, or legal issue.
    • Red Flags:
      • Urgent requests for money.
      • Instructions to keep the situation a secret.
      • Requests to send money via wire transfer or prepaid debit card.
    • Protect Yourself:
      • Verify the story by contacting the grandchild directly or another family member.
      • Be wary of requests for secrecy.
      • Never send money without confirming the emergency.
  5. Debt Collection Scams:
    • How it Works: Scammers pose as debt collectors and claim you owe a debt. They may use aggressive tactics to pressure you into making payments.
    • Red Flags:
      • Threats of legal action or arrest.
      • Refusal to provide details about the debt.
      • Demands for payment on a debt you don’t recognize.
